How Much Does Tree Removal Cost in Muhlenberg?

The cost of tree removal varies depending on the number of trees, the size of those trees, and how secure and straightforward they are to access. In Muhlenberg, homeowners pay around $561 for tree removal services, with prices ranging from $216 to $888.

Some situations call for emergency tree removal, such as if an intense storm partially dislodges a tree near your home. Emergency tree removal in Muhlenberg is, on average, $838.

Signs That a Tree Needs to Be Removed

Muhlenberg has a significant number of aging trees, which are more prone to damage, disease, and general wear and tear. Signs that a tree should be removed include:

  • Cracking between branches , especially large heavy ones
  • The trunk branches off in different directions into multiple large , heavy branches
  • Cracks in the trunk , especially deep cracks
  • Fungus or mold
  • Rot , dead branches , missing bark or leaves , and other signs of decay

When you spot a tree leaning or discover raised dirt around the base, you should arrange an immediate evaluation, as it is at an increased risk of falling. If a tree is nearing your house or utility lines, you may also need an assessment, as numerous communities and utility companies have particular policies for tree proximity.

Do Tree Removal Companies Need to be Licensed in Pennsylvania?

Pennsylvania does not have specific licensing requirements for tree removal companies, but it’s important to check with your local municipal government to ensure your provider meets the requirements in your area. Opt for a reputable business that carries workers compensation and liability insurance. For additional peace of mind, hire a licensed contractor who provides tree removal services. An individual can also become a licensed arborist through the International Society of Arboriculture (ISA). While not required, this certification indicates that an individual is trained in all aspects of arboriculture and follows the ISA’s code of ethics. You can search for a licensed arborist or verify credentials on the ISA’s search tool.

In Muhlenberg, stump removal costs around $174. Depending on the size of the stump and removal difficulty, this price can range from $201 to $321. Since not every tree removal company offers stump grinding or removal, ask about these services before agreeing to a contract.

In Muhlenberg, you'll commonly find trees such as the red maple, chestnut oak, and the yellow-poplar. Trees in this region are 48 feet tall on average and have an average age of 82 years.

In several areas, even if you own your property, you do need a permit to remove a tree. Consult with a tree removal specialist near you to help you understand zoning regulations in your area and get a permit.

Ways you can keep your trees healthy include periodically pruning overgrown or dead branches, keeping heavy lawn equipment or vehicles off the roots, and topping up soil around the base if it starts to erode. Consider pest control services if insects are negatively affecting your trees.

Yes, you should stay at your home during tree removal. Your tree removal specialist may have questions, and being present lets you point out exactly which trees need to be removed, giving you peace of mind that the job is being done properly and safely. If a tree is very close to your house, your provider may ask everyone to wait outside while the tree is being removed.

Consult your tree removal provider before cutting, but typically, you can hold onto the wood from trees downed on your property. If you don’t want to keep the wood, ask your tree removal provider if they'll remove it, or contact your local waste removal department to find the best way to get rid of it. Be careful not to leave fallen trees for too long, and don’t stack cut wood against the side of your house, as both can attract pests.
